KSL strategy pays off


KSL Holdings Bhd's main rental income contribution comes from KSL City, the integrated development in Johor Bahru city centre comprising a mall, a five-star hotel and two blocks of serviced apartments.

SPEAK of the Johor property market and it brings to mind the myriad players, foreign and local, who are riding on the Iskandar Malaysia masterplan.

For KSL Holdings Bhd, where Johor has always been its playground, the secret to its well-run business is in knowing what the locals want and sticking to areas its knows how to extract the best returns from.
